Nathan Waller
Northwestern University clinical faculty instructor/lecturer and licensed speech-language pathologist Dr. Waller specializes in treatment for voice and airway disorders. A professionally trained singer and former chorus director, Dr. Waller is interested in the diagnoses and treatment of voice disorders in both singers and non-singers. Beyond working in the area of voice/airway disorders, he has a special interest in transgender and gender expansive voice/communication therapy. nathanwallerslp.com
Education
- SLPD, Doctor of Speech-Language Pathology, Northwestern University
- Clinical Fellowship - Bastian Voice Institute
- MA, Speech-Language Pathology, University of North Carolina at Greensboro
- MM, Masters in Music (Voice), Appalachian State University
- BM, Music Education, University of North Carolina at Charlotte
